Claims Adjusters, Examiners, and Investigators Salary in Texas

Ranked #26 of 51 · TX

1.1% below U.S. average
Mean annual salary $79,560 ≈ $38/hr
Median annual salary $78,800
Employment 29,220

Salary Distribution (10th–90th percentile)

P10 $46,560P25 $59,780 Median $78,800P75 $97,990P90 $116,610

About 80% of claims adjusters, examiners, and investigatorss in Texas earn between $46,560 and $116,610. The blue band is the middle 50% (P25–P75); the dot marks the median.

The mean claims adjusters, examiners, and investigators salary in Texas is $79,560, about 1.1% below the U.S. average ($80,470). That works out to roughly $38/hr at 2,080 hours per year.
